Victory and Hope: Manchester United's Impressive 2-0 Win Over City
In an exciting turn of events, Manchester United secured a resounding 2-0 victory against their rivals Manchester City in the Premier League, marking a brilliant start for interim head coach Michael Carrick. The match, held at Old Trafford, showcased United's tactical prowess and relentless spirit, leaving fans optimistic about the team's future.
Impactful Leadership
Lisandro Martinez, a key player in the match, expressed his admiration for Carrick’s immediate influence on the team despite being appointed just days prior. His leadership facilitated a swift transformation, encouraging players to exhibit confidence with the ball while emphasizing a steadfast defensive strategy. This was evident as United maintained control throughout the match, effectively executing their game plan.
A Historic Return
The victory not only helped United move up to fifth place in the Premier League table but also marked a celebratory return for Bryan Mbeumo, who scored one of the goals after his remarkable performances for his national team at the Africa Cup of Nations. His contribution, along with Patrick Dorgu's stellar performance, played a pivotal role in overwhelming City, showcasing the depth and talent present in the squad.
